- The distance between Aden, Yemen and Maturin, Venezuela is approximately 11,700 km or 7,270 mi.
- To reach Aden in this distance one would set out from Maturin bearing 73.7°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Aden bearing 104° or ESE .
- Aden has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Maturin has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- The average annual temperature is 3.2 °C (5.7°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.4 °C (9.7°F) more in Aden.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1297 mm (51.1 in) less which is equivalent to 1297 l/m² (31.83 US gal/ft²) or 12,970,000 l/ha (1,386,579 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1° lower in Aden than in Maturin.
- Relative humidity levels are 21.3%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 2.1°C (3.7°F) lower.
